GS8B022370JGT Description
GS8B022370JGT Description
The GS8B022370JGT from TT Electronics/IRC is a high-performance ceramic resistor network designed for precision applications. This 16-pin narrow SOIC device features 15 bussed resistors with a 237Ω resistance value and a ±5% absolute tolerance, ensuring reliable performance in demanding circuits. Built with thin-film technology, it offers a ±50ppm/°C temperature coefficient, making it stable across a 70°C to 125°C operating range. The SOIC package (9.91mm x 5.99mm x 1.45mm) provides a compact footprint, while the gull-wing termination ensures secure surface mounting. Rated for 100V maximum voltage and 0.8W total power dissipation, it is ideal for space-constrained designs requiring robust thermal management.
GS8B022370JGT Features
- Bussed Network Design: Simplifies PCB layout by connecting multiple resistors in a single package.
- High Power Handling: 0.05W per resistor (total 0.8W) with derating up to 125°C.
- Stable Thin-Film Technology: Delivers ±50ppm/°C TCR for minimal resistance drift.
- Precision Tolerance: ±5% absolute and ±2% ratio tolerance for matched performance.
- Robust Construction: Ceramic case ensures durability and thermal stability.
- Compact SOIC Package: 9.91mm length, 5.99mm depth, 1.45mm height for high-density layouts.
